Cottonwood Reservoir Fishing Report

Cottonwood Reservoir - Lakeview, OR (Lake County)


by ODFW
8-9-2023
Website

Trolling and bank fishing will slow down as the water temperatures increase during the summer. Fishing morning and evenings will be the best option for people wanting to catch rainbow trout. Fishing with flies and lures out of a boat in areas where vegetation is limited is the go-to for this lake.‌

Fishing from the bank can be productive, but try casting lures and flies into areas with lower vegetation to catch more fish. As vegetation increases this summer remember to lengthen your leader.
